Plot Summary

A manager of an American casual restaurant chain is invited to an immersive educational "university" in Italy to learn the ropes of the vibrant fast-casual business. Once there, she falls for her charming Italian tour guide, only to discover that the experience is not what it seems.

Critical Reception

Spin Me Round received mixed to positive reviews from critics, who praised its quirky humor and the performances of its ensemble cast, particularly Alison Brie and Alessandro Nivola. However, some found the plot to be meandering and the tone inconsistent, leading to a divisive audience reception.

Fun Fact

Director Jeff Baena and star Alison Brie, who are married in real life, frequently collaborate on films, with Brie often playing complex, darkly comedic characters.
